The Sophomore Freshman debate of the interclass series will take place this evening in Sever 11 at 7.30 o'clock. The 1916 team, composed of H. Epstein, P. L. Sayre, and C. A. Trafford, will uphold the affirmative, and the 1917 team composed of A. G. Paine, D. A. Kriesfeld, and J. H. Spits the negative of the question "Resolved, That all elective state and municipal officers (except judges) be subject to the recall."
The judges will be Mr. J. S. Davis, B. H. Knollenberg 1L. and S. M. Seymour 1L., J. Russell, Jr., '17 will preside. The winners of this debate will meet the Juniors one-week from tonight for the interclass championship.
